
You play as Link, a young boy destined to save the land of Hyrule. The core objective is to explore dungeons, solve environmental puzzles, and defeat enemies to collect spiritual stones and medallions. In the early game, focus on mastering basic sword combat, using your shield to block attacks, and learning to target-lock on foes with the Z-button. As you progress, you will acquire essential items like the Slingshot, Bombs, and the Boomerang to solve puzzles and access new areas. A key mechanic is playing the Ocarina of Time to learn songs that manipulate the environment, warp to specific locations, and even change the time period from childhood to adulthood. The middle of the game involves navigating more complex dungeons as an adult, where the puzzles and enemies become significantly more challenging. In tense moments, especially during boss fights, carefully observe attack patterns, use your most powerful items like the Hookshot or the Megaton Hammer, and manage your health with fairies or potions. The challenge rhythm involves a mix of exploration, combat, and puzzle-solving, culminating in a final confrontation with Ganondorf.
